[Lunar-commits] <moonbase> firefox: updated to 8.0

Zbigniew Luszpinski zbiggy at lunar-linux.org
Sat Nov 12 17:16:53 CET 2011


commit d26eda32c61b2da91b925ff1e88bf56422966619
Author: Zbigniew Luszpinski <zbiggy at lunar-linux.org>
Date:   Sat Nov 12 17:16:53 2011 +0100

    firefox: updated to 8.0
---
 web/firefox/BUILD        |    4 ++--
 web/firefox/DETAILS      |    6 +++---
 web/firefox/POST_INSTALL |   14 ++++----------
 web/firefox/POST_REMOVE  |    1 -
 4 files changed, 9 insertions(+), 16 deletions(-)

diff --git a/web/firefox/BUILD b/web/firefox/BUILD
index 827901c..ee8f06a 100644
--- a/web/firefox/BUILD
+++ b/web/firefox/BUILD
@@ -1,7 +1,7 @@
 (
 
-  sedit 's/^GENERATE_CACHE .*/GENERATE_CACHE = true/' toolkit/mozapps/installer/packager.mk &&
-  sedit 's/@PRE_RELEASE_SUFFIX@//g' browser/base/content/browser.xul &&
+  # Workaround Segmentation fault at install part on precompile_cache.js
+  sedit '/^GENERATE_CACHE = 1$/d' browser/installer/Makefile.in &&
 
   if module_is_expired $MODULE && [ "$VERSION" != "`installed_version $MODULE`" ]; then
     set_module_config OLD_VER "`installed_version $MODULE`"
diff --git a/web/firefox/DETAILS b/web/firefox/DETAILS
index 7a3579f..226ff7b 100644
--- a/web/firefox/DETAILS
+++ b/web/firefox/DETAILS
@@ -1,14 +1,14 @@
           MODULE=firefox
-         VERSION=7.0.1
+         VERSION=8.0
           SOURCE=firefox-$VERSION.source.tar.bz2
    SOURCE_URL[0]=ftp://ftp.uni-erlangen.de/pub/mozilla.org/firefox/releases/$VERSION/source
    SOURCE_URL[1]=ftp://mozilla.isc.org/pub/mozilla.org/firefox/releases/$VERSION/source
    SOURCE_URL[2]=ftp://ftp.mozilla.org/pub/firefox/releases/$VERSION/source
-      SOURCE_VFY=sha1:94bbc7152832371dc0be82f411730df043c5c6ac
+      SOURCE_VFY=sha1:843cf4ad70d2fc4b16654c3ff9b080d3eb357452
 SOURCE_DIRECTORY=$BUILD_DIRECTORY/mozilla-release
         WEB_SITE=http://www.mozilla.org/projects/firefox
          ENTERED=20110814
-         UPDATED=20110930
+         UPDATED=20111111
            SHORT="A speedy, full-featured web browser"
 
 cat << EOF
diff --git a/web/firefox/POST_INSTALL b/web/firefox/POST_INSTALL
index dded3db..b582b98 100644
--- a/web/firefox/POST_INSTALL
+++ b/web/firefox/POST_INSTALL
@@ -10,22 +10,16 @@ if [ ! -z "$OLD_VER" ] && [ "$OLD_VER" != "$NEW_VER" ] ; then
     rm -rf /usr/lib/firefox-devel-$old_version
     rm -rf /usr/include/firefox-$old_version
     rm -rf /usr/share/idl/firefox-$old_version
-    rm -rf /usr/lib/gcc/i686-pc-linux-gnu/4.5.2/include-fixed/firefox-$old_version
   done
 fi
 
 unset_module_config OLD_VER
 
 # Clean up old firefox junk
-rm -rf /usr/lib/firefox-[0-6]*
-rm -rf /usr/lib/firefox-7.0
-rm -rf /usr/lib/firefox-devel-[0-6]*
-rm -rf /usr/lib/firefox-devel-7.0
-rm -rf /usr/include/firefox-[0-6]*
-rm -rf /usr/include/firefox-7.0
-rm -rf /usr/share/idl/firefox-[0-6]*
-rm -rf /usr/share/idl/firefox-7.0
-rm -rf /usr/lib/gcc/i686-pc-linux-gnu/4.5.2/include-fixed/firefox-[0-6]*
+rm -rf /usr/lib/firefox-[0-7]*
+rm -rf /usr/lib/firefox-devel-[0-7]*
+rm -rf /usr/include/firefox-[0-7]*
+rm -rf /usr/share/idl/firefox-[0-7]*
 
 export LD_LIBRARY_PATH="$FIREFOX_HOME/lib/$FFOX_LIBDIR:$FIREFOX_HOME/lib/$FFOX_LIBDIR/plugins:$FIREFOX_HOME/lib/$FFOX_LIBDIR/components"
 export MOZILLA_FIVE_HOME="$FIREFOX_HOME/lib/$FFOX_LIBDIR"
diff --git a/web/firefox/POST_REMOVE b/web/firefox/POST_REMOVE
index ecb70e2..7e93eea 100644
--- a/web/firefox/POST_REMOVE
+++ b/web/firefox/POST_REMOVE
@@ -7,4 +7,3 @@ rm -f  /usr/share/pixmaps/firefox48.png
 rm -rf /usr/include/firefox*
 rm -rf /usr/share/idl/firefox*
 rm -rf /usr/lib/firefox*
-rm -rf /usr/lib/gcc/i686-pc-linux-gnu/4.5.2/include-fixed/firefox*


More information about the Lunar-commits mailing list